The FREECOM 4X is Cardo's premium Bluetooth-only intercom — no DMC mesh, but a comprehensive feature set at the top of the Bluetooth category. Bluetooth 5.2 provides a faster and more stable chipset than the 4.x standard in many competing units. Live Intercom connects up to four riders with wideband HD audio and auto-reconnect. 40mm JBL speakers with JBL EQ profiles, jog dial for gloved control, parallel audio streaming (music and intercom simultaneously), automatic volume adjustment, FM radio, and OTA updates via USB-C. Waterproof for all-weather use across a 1.2km range with 13 hours talk time.

  • FREECOM 4X vs PACKTALK PRO — which to choose: The FREECOM 4X is Bluetooth-only; the PACKTALK PRO uses DMC mesh. Bluetooth intercom connects riders in a chain — if one link drops, communication breaks for riders beyond that point, and the maximum group is 4. DMC mesh connects all riders simultaneously, self-heals when someone drops out, and scales to 15. Choose the FREECOM 4X for small groups of 2–4 riders where Bluetooth reliability is sufficient. Choose the PACKTALK PRO for larger groups, remote solo riding (impact detection), or routes where connectivity reliability matters more than cost.
  • Bluetooth 5.2 — practical benefit over 4.x: Bluetooth 5.2 improves connection stability and re-pairing speed compared to the 4.x chipset used in many competing units. In practice, faster reconnect means the intercom re-establishes contact more quickly after a signal drop (tunnel, large distance gap) without requiring manual intervention. Bluetooth 5.2 is backward-compatible — it pairs with older Bluetooth devices, but the performance improvements only apply when both devices are running 5.x.
  • Parallel audio — music and intercom simultaneously: The FREECOM 4X streams music from a paired phone while maintaining the intercom channel open — incoming intercom audio plays over or alongside the music without requiring the music to be stopped first. The automatic volume feature lowers music volume when intercom or call audio activates, then restores it afterward. This combination means no manual audio management during group rides — the unit handles priority switching automatically.
  • Jog dial — why it matters for gloved use: Most intercoms use buttons — small targets that require precise finger placement through thick gloves. The jog dial is a rotating wheel that can be turned or pressed without precision targeting, making volume adjustment and function selection achievable with winter gloves or gauntlets. If you ride primarily in cold weather with thick gloves, the jog dial is a meaningful usability advantage over button-only designs.
  • Universal pairing — same limitation as PACKTALK PRO: The FREECOM 4X pairs with headsets from Sena, Midland, and other brands via standard Bluetooth intercom. When connected to a non-Cardo headset, both units operate in standard Bluetooth mode — Live Intercom group features apply only within Cardo-to-Cardo connections. The 2-channel connectivity (Phone + GPS simultaneously) means you can pair a smartphone for calls/music and a GPS device at the same time without switching between them manually.
Feature Performance
🔊
40mm JBL + JBL EQ Profiles
40mm JBL drivers are at the top of the standard intercom speaker range — the PACKTALK PRO's 45mm drivers are larger, but 40mm significantly outperforms the 35mm drivers in budget intercoms. JBL EQ profiles adjust frequency response curves for different content types: music listening vs voice intercom vs navigation prompts each benefit from different EQ settings. The profiles are configurable in the Cardo Connect app. At highway speed above 100km/h, road and wind noise occupies the mid-frequency band — the JBL tuning compensates by lifting these frequencies above the noise floor.
🔁
Live Intercom — Auto-Reconnect
Live Intercom maintains an always-open audio channel between paired riders — conversation flows naturally without push-to-talk activation. Auto-reconnect re-establishes the Bluetooth link automatically when riders come back into range after a separation, without requiring manual pairing. The 4-rider limit is inherent to the Bluetooth chain topology — adding a 5th rider requires a unit that supports mesh networking. Pair the group in sequence before departing, not ad-hoc at the roadside with gloves on.
📻
FM Radio
FM radio plays through the JBL speakers without requiring smartphone pairing or data connection — useful in areas with poor cellular coverage where streaming fails. FM radio and intercom operate simultaneously: incoming intercom audio interrupts or overlays the FM audio depending on priority settings. The FM antenna uses the speaker cable as its receiver — ensure the cable is routed without sharp bends that could degrade reception. FM radio is a legacy feature that distinguishes the FREECOM 4X from stripped-down intercom units that omit it.
🔊
Automatic Volume Adjustment
The automatic volume feature uses a microphone to sample ambient noise level and adjusts speaker output accordingly — louder at highway speed, quieter at low urban speeds. This prevents the common problem of setting volume for a quiet car park and finding it inaudible at 100km/h, or the reverse. The sensitivity of the auto-adjustment is configurable in Cardo Connect. At very high ambient noise levels (above approximately 90dB, common at sustained highway speed), even maximum volume may not fully overcome road noise — ear plugs worn under the helmet significantly improve audibility.
🎙️
Natural Voice Operation
Voice commands allow hands-free control of calls, music, intercom pairing, and navigation without button presses. The FREECOM 4X uses Cardo's own voice command vocabulary — it does not integrate with Siri, Google Assistant, or Alexa natively, but can activate them by voice-initiating a phone call to the assistant. The microphone picks up voice commands while filtering wind noise through DSP processing — voice recognition performance degrades at very high ambient noise above 95dB. A boom microphone (included) performs better than a chin-bar mounted flat microphone in high-wind conditions.
🔋
13H Battery + Fast Charging
13 hours talk time covers most full riding days without mid-ride charging. The rated figure is measured under controlled conditions — real-world battery life varies with intercom use intensity, speaker volume, and ambient temperature (cold reduces lithium battery capacity). Fast charging via USB-C restores significant charge in 30–45 minutes — useful at lunch stops on touring days. Store at approximately 50% charge if the unit will not be used for more than two weeks. The USB-C port's IP seal should be inspected annually for damage before the charging port is used in rain-likely conditions.
Key Highlights
No. 1
Bluetooth Chain Topology — 4-Rider Limit Is Absolute
The FREECOM 4X's 4-rider maximum is not a Cardo-specific limitation — it reflects how Bluetooth intercom chains work. Bluetooth point-to-point connections are daisy-chained: each unit connects to two neighbours. Beyond 4 units, chain management becomes unreliable and latency increases. If your group regularly rides with 5 or more riders, the FREECOM 4X is the wrong product category regardless of brand — DMC mesh (PACKTALK PRO) or another mesh-capable system is the appropriate solution for groups of 5–15.
No. 2
1.2km Range — Real-World vs Rated
The 1.2km range is measured in open terrain between two stationary units with no obstructions. In practice, range in urban environments with buildings is typically 200–400m per connection link. On twisting roads, range between consecutive riders depends on the curvature — a single blind corner can reduce effective range to under 100m for that link. The Bluetooth chain amplifies this: if any single link in the 4-rider chain drops, the two sub-groups can no longer communicate until they come back into range of the dropped link's unit.
No. 3
Two-Channel Connectivity — Phone + GPS Simultaneously
The FREECOM 4X maintains two simultaneous Bluetooth connections to external devices — typically a smartphone and a GPS unit. This means turn-by-turn navigation audio from the GPS plays through the helmet speakers at the same time as music from the phone, with intercom as the highest-priority audio channel. Without two-channel connectivity (a limitation of some budget intercoms), riders must choose between GPS audio and music, disconnecting one to use the other. Confirm your GPS device's Bluetooth profile is compatible with the FREECOM 4X's secondary audio channel before purchasing.
No. 4
Mount Options — Stick-on vs Clamp
The FREECOM 4X ships with both stick-on and clamp mounting options — the stick-on base uses adhesive pads on the helmet shell; the clamp wraps around the helmet's external padding or ventilation rails. The clamp mount is reversible with no adhesive residue, making it suitable for expensive helmets where adhesive is undesirable, carbon fibre shells where adhesive compatibility is uncertain, or riders who switch the unit between multiple helmets. The stick-on base provides a lower-profile installation but is not removable without adhesive residue.
No. 5
OTA Updates — Check Before First Ride
OTA updates via the Cardo Connect app deliver firmware improvements including bug fixes, voice command additions, and Bluetooth compatibility patches. Check for available updates immediately after purchase and install before the first group ride — pairing behaviour between units is most consistent when all units in the group are running the same firmware version. Updates require the unit to remain stationary with adequate battery charge; a unit that powers off mid-update can require a hardware reset to recover.
No. 6
Waterproof — No IP Rating Listed
The FREECOM 4X is described as "fully waterproof" but no specific IP rating (IP65, IP67, IP68) is listed in the specification. The PACKTALK PRO specifies IP67. Before riding in heavy rain or water immersion scenarios, confirm the exact IP rating with the seller or on Cardo's product page. "Waterproof" without a rated IP standard means the protection level is unverified to a defined test — it typically covers rain and splashing but may not cover submersion. For touring in heavy rain, confirm the IP rating matches your expected conditions.
